Specifications and technical data
- SKU: 2248108
- Mark: Ford
- Condition: Used
- OEM Part Number: 2248108
- Substitutable numbers: 6G91-12T551-AB, 6G9112T551AB, 2248108
- Fuel type: Diesel
- Part type: Sensor
- Category: Engine Sensors & Switches
Function of the MAP sensor in a Ford diesel engine
The boost pressure MAP sensor in Ford diesel engines is responsible for measuring air pressure in the intake manifold, both during boosted operation and under no-load conditions. Based on the signal from this component, the engine control unit calculates the amount of air entering the cylinders and then adjusts the fuel dose, which is crucial for smooth operation, performance, and exhaust emission levels.
In vehicles such as the Galaxy Mk2 and Mondeo Mk4, a properly functioning MAP sensor helps reduce problems typical for diesel units, such as power loss, increased fuel consumption, or entering limp mode. A stable signal from the sensor also supports correct cooperation with the turbocharger and the exhaust gas recirculation system.
